1. A lithium secondary battery, comprising:
a positive electrode;
a negative electrode;
a separator interposed between the positive electrode and the negative electrode; and
a sulfur dioxide-based inorganic electrolyte solution,
wherein the negative electrode comprises a negative electrode active material, which comprises a carbon material having a coating comprising titanium oxide, wherein the titanium oxide comprises a mixture of TiO, TiO0.5, TiO0.68 and TiO1.3,
wherein the positive electrode comprises active material particles of Li, LiCoO2, LiNiO2, LiMn2O4, LiCoPO4, LiFePO4, LiNi1-x-y-zCoxM1yM2xO2 (M1 and M2 are independently Al, Ni, Co, Fe, Mn, V, Cr, Ti, W, Ta, Mg, Mo or two or more of them, and x, y and z are independently atomic fractions of elements in the oxide composition, where 0≤x≤0.5, 0≤y<0.5, 0≤z<0.5, 0≤x+y+z<1) or two or more of them,
wherein the separator comprises glass fibers, and
wherein the carbon material is obtained by:
dispersing a titanium oxide precursor in a solvent to prepare a sol solution,
thereafter reacting the sol solution and a carbon material to induce a sol-gel reaction, and
performing a thermal treatment.
